The tissue in the wall of the stomach that helps in the movement of food is primarily smooth muscle. This smooth muscle is organized into three layers—longitudinal, circular, and oblique—which contract rhythmically to churn and mix food, facilitating digestion. These contractions, known as peristalsis, help propel the food towards the small intestine.

The muscle between the esophagus and stomach, called the lower esophageal sphincter, helps control the flow of food and liquids into the stomach. It opens to allow food to enter the stomach and then closes to prevent stomach contents from flowing back up into the esophagus. This helps prevent acid reflux and aids in the digestion process by keeping food in the stomach where it can be broken down by stomach acids and enzymes.
